@media (max-width: 1000px) {
    .slider-colaboradores .contenedor-slider-colaboradores,#buscador-home,.subcuerpo-izquierda .que-esta-pasando{
        width:auto;
    }
    #articulos-destacados-home{
        margin-left:0;
    }
    .row,#buscador-home,#buscador-home #searchform #s,
    #page section .uncuarto aside, #page section .content, #page section#post-destacado article,
    #subcuerpo-home-ineaf,#subcuerpo-home-ineaf .subcuerpo-izquierda,.subcuerpo-izquierda .que-esta-pasando{
        max-width: 100%;
    }
    #buscador-home #searchform #s{
        box-sizing: border-box;
        background-position: 2% 50%;
        margin-top:6px;
    }
    #post-destacado .entry-title{
        font-size:28px;
    }
    #post-destacado .contenedor-titulo{
        width:auto;
        height:auto;
    }
    #subcuerpo-home-ineaf .subcuerpo-derecha{
        width:96%;
        margin-top:20px;
    }
    #articulos-destacados-home .articulo .titulo{
        height:auto;
        padding-bottom:10px;
    }
    .bloque-newsletter-derecha{
        margin:auto;
    }
    .home #secondary{
        margin-top:0px!important;
    }
    #articulos-destacados-home .articulo{
        min-height: auto;
    }
    #subcuerpo-home-ineaf .subcuerpo-izquierda{
        width:96%;
    }
    #subcuerpo-home-ineaf .separador-ultimos-articulos,#subcuerpo-home-ineaf .ultimos-articulos-tribuna .columna-dcha{
        width:47%;
    }
    #subcuerpo-home-ineaf .ultimos-articulos-tribuna .columna-izq,#buscador-home #searchform #s{
        width:100%;
    }
    #secondary .widget_execphp{
        float:initial;
    }
    .subcuerpo-derecha .actualidad-ineaf .entry-summary .post-imagen{
        float:initial;
        margin:auto;
    }
    .subcuerpo-derecha .video-tribuna .video iframe{
        display:block;
        margin-left:auto;
        margin-right:auto;
    }
    .single #primary,.search-results #primary{
        margin-left:0px;
    }
    .single #secondary .widget_execphp,.archive.category #secondary .widget_execphp,
    .search-results #secondary .widget_execphp{
        float:left;
        min-width:auto;
    }
    .single #secondary .widget_execphp#execphp-4,.archive.category #secondary .widget_execphp#execphp-4,
    .search-results #secondary .widget_execphp#execphp-4{
        width:100%;
    }
    .single #secondary .widget_execphp#execphp-4 li,.archive.category #secondary .widget_execphp#execphp-4 li,
    .search-results #secondary .widget_execphp#execphp-4 li{
        float:initial;
    }
    .category .thumbnail > img, .archive .thumbnail > img{
        margin:auto!important;
        float:initial;
    }
    .search-results .thumbnail > img{
        margin:auto!important;
    }
    .search-results #buscador{
        width:97%;
    }
    .search-results #buscador #searchform #s{
        width:94%;
        margin:0;
        background-position: 1% 50%;
    }

}
@media (max-width: 767px) {
    #post-destacado .cuerpo-post-destacado .resumen{
        margin:0;
        width:100%;
    }
    #post-destacado .cuerpo-post-destacado .imagen-post-destacado,
    #subcuerpo-home-ineaf .subcuerpo-izquierda
    {
        width:100%;
    }
    #post-destacado article{
        height:auto;
    }
    .pie-post-destacado{
        position:static;
    }
    .boton-rs{
        margin-bottom:7px;
    }
    #subcuerpo-home-ineaf .ultimos-articulos-tribuna{
        padding:15px;
    }
    #subcuerpo-home-ineaf .separador-ultimos-articulos{
        padding:0;
        width:100%;
        border:none;
    }
    #subcuerpo-home-ineaf .ultimos-articulos-tribuna .columna-dcha{
        width:100%;
        margin:0;
    }
    #subcuerpo-home-ineaf .ultimos-articulos-tribuna .columna-izq{
        margin:0;
    }
    .single #secondary .widget_execphp,.archive.category #secondary .widget_execphp{
        width:95%;
    }
    #contenedor-formulario-cursos-relacionados,#execphp-7 .execphpwidget{
        margin:auto;
    }
    .banner-col-derecha,.bloque-foro-derecha{
        margin:auto;
    }
    #execphp-7 .execphpwidget{
        float:initial;
        margin-left:15px;
    }

    #articulos-destacados-home .articulo .cuerpo p,.subcuerpo-izquierda .que-esta-pasando .cuerpo p{
        width:100%;
        margin-left:0;
    }
    #articulos-destacados-home .titulo-articulos-destacados span,
    #subcuerpo-home-ineaf .titulo-bloque span{
        font-size:22px;
        margin-left:10px;
    }
    .subcuerpo-izquierda .que-esta-pasando .cuerpo img{
        float:initial;
    }
    .subcuerpo-izquierda .que-esta-pasando .cuerpo a{
        display:block;
        text-align: center;
    }
    .ultimo-articulo-tribuna .entry-meta .meta-datos{
        width:auto;
    }
    article .entry-title{
        font-size:22px;
    }
    #primary .wpp-list li{
        width:50%;
    }
    #primary .wpp-list a{
        width:auto;
    }
    .redes-sociales-single-post{
        top:60px;
    }
    .single .entry-meta{
        height:90px;
    }
    .search-results #buscador{
        width:94%;
    }
    .search-results #buscador #searchform #s{
        width:85%;
    }
    #buscador-home{
        margin-left:5px;
    }
    .archive.category .entry-meta .entry-date{
        width:60%;
    }
    .archive.category h1{
        font-size:30px!important;
    }
    .archive.category.category-actualidad-economia-empresa h1{
        font-size: 18px !important;
    }
    #articulos-destacados-home .articulo .cuerpo .contenedor-imagen img{
        position:static;
    }
    #articulos-destacados-home .articulo .cuerpo .contenedor-imagen{
        margin-right:10px;
    }
    .enlace-foro-relacionado{
        margin-right:0;
        width:80%;
        float:initial;
    }
    .img-foro-relacionado {
        float:left;
    }
}
@media (max-width: 400px) {
    #articulos-destacados-home .articulo .cuerpo .contenedor-imagen {
        width: 100%;
    }
    #articulos-destacados-home .articulo .cuerpo .contenedor-imagen img{
        position: absolute;
    }
    #articulos-destacados-home .articulo .cuerpo .contenedor-imagen{
        margin-right:0;
    }
    .archive.category.paged.paged-2 .pagination ul > li > a{
        padding: 4px 12px;
    }
    .archive.category.paged .pagination ul > li > a{
        padding: 4px 8px;
    }
}
@media(min-width: 532px) and (max-width: 767px){
    .archive.category #secondary .widget_execphp{
        width:auto;
    }
    .archive.category #secondary #execphp-12{
        width:100%;
        margin-top:10px;
    }
    .archive.category #secondary{
        display: flex;
        flex-wrap: wrap;
        justify-content: center;
    }
}
.archive.category #execphp-4 .field-field-cat-principal .field-item{
    margin-left:47px;
}